能ping但是没法v2ray的原因及解决方案

在现代网络环境中,V2Ray作为一种流行的代理工具,广泛应用于科学上网和网络隐私保护。然而,有些用户在使用V2Ray时,可能会遇到一种情况:能够ping通目标服务器,但无法正常使用V2Ray。这种现象可能由多种原因引起,本文将对此进行详细分析,并提供相应的解决方案。

1. 什么是V2Ray?

V2Ray是一个功能强大的网络代理工具,支持多种协议和传输方式。它的主要功能包括:

  • 科学上网:帮助用户突破网络限制,访问被屏蔽的网站。
  • 隐私保护:通过加密传输,保护用户的网络隐私。
  • 多协议支持:支持VMess、Shadowsocks等多种协议。

2. 能ping通但无法使用V2Ray的常见原因

2.1 网络配置问题

在某些情况下,网络配置可能导致V2Ray无法正常工作。常见的网络配置问题包括:

  • DNS解析错误:如果DNS服务器配置不正确,可能导致V2Ray无法找到目标服务器。
  • 路由问题:网络路由设置不当,可能导致数据包无法正确到达目标。

2.2 防火墙设置

防火墙可能会阻止V2Ray的流量,导致用户能够ping通目标服务器,但无法使用V2Ray。常见的防火墙设置问题包括:

  • 端口被阻塞:V2Ray使用的端口可能被防火墙阻止。
  • 流量过滤:某些防火墙会过滤特定类型的流量,导致V2Ray无法正常工作。

2.3 V2Ray配置错误

V2Ray的配置文件如果设置不当,也会导致无法正常使用。常见的配置错误包括:

  • 服务器地址错误:配置文件中的服务器地址不正确。
  • 端口号错误:配置文件中的端口号与实际使用的端口不一致。

3. 解决方案

3.1 检查网络配置

  • 确认DNS设置:确保DNS服务器设置正确,可以尝试使用公共DNS(如8.8.8.8)。
  • 检查路由设置:使用tracert命令检查数据包的路由情况,确保数据包能够正确到达目标。

3.2 调整防火墙设置

  • 允许V2Ray端口:在防火墙中添加规则,允许V2Ray使用的端口通过。
  • 禁用流量过滤:如果可能,禁用防火墙的流量过滤功能,测试V2Ray是否能够正常工作。

3.3 修正V2Ray配置

  • 检查配置文件:仔细检查V2Ray的配置文件,确保服务器地址和端口号正确无误。
  • 使用默认配置:如果不确定配置是否正确,可以尝试使用V2Ray的默认配置进行测试。

4. 常见问题解答(FAQ)

4.1 为什么能ping通但无法使用V2Ray?

这种情况通常是由于网络配置、防火墙设置或V2Ray配置错误导致的。建议逐一排查这些问题。

4.2 如何检查V2Ray的配置是否正确?

可以通过查看V2Ray的配置文件,确认服务器地址、端口号和协议设置是否正确。同时,可以查看V2Ray的日志文件,获取更多错误信息。

4.3 V2Ray的常见错误代码有哪些?

常见的错误代码包括:

  • 10001:连接超时。
  • 10002:无效的配置。
  • 10003:无法连接到服务器。

4.4 如何提高V2Ray的连接稳定性?

  • 选择合适的服务器:选择延迟低、带宽高
正文完
 0